使用N-MOS实现的双向电平转换器在I²C总线系统中的应用

需积分: 36 7 下载量 58 浏览量 更新于2024-07-18 收藏 67KB PDF 举报
"AN97055 - Philips Semiconductors的应用笔记,介绍了一种使用单个N-MOS场效应晶体管实现的双向电平转换器,用于连接具有不同电源电压(如5伏和3.3伏)的I²C总线系统。该电平转换器还可隔离低功耗设备的总线部分,使I²C总线的有电部分能正常工作,适用于其他总线系统或点对点连接的电平转换和/或隔离。" 在电子设计中,尤其是在多电压域系统中,电平转换是至关重要的。I²C(Inter-Integrated Circuit)总线是一种常见的两线式串行通信接口,用于连接微控制器和其他设备。当I²C总线上的设备由不同电源电压供电时,例如一个设备运行在5V,另一个运行在3.3V,需要电平转换器确保信号在不同电压等级之间正确传输,同时防止损坏低电压设备。 本应用笔记"Bi-directional level shifter for I²C-bus and other systems"(AN97055)提出了一种基于N-MOS场效应晶体管的双向电平转换器设计方案。N-MOSFET(N沟道金属氧化物半导体场效应晶体管)在这里被用作开关元件,因为它可以在低电压下有效地控制电流流动。其工作原理是利用N-MOSFET的栅极-源极电压(Vgs)来控制漏极-源极导通状态。当Vgs高于阈值电压时,N-MOSFET导通,允许电流通过;反之,当Vgs低于阈值电压时,N-MOSFET截止,阻止电流流动。 在双向电平转换器中,两个N-MOSFET通常以互补方式配置,一个用于从高电压到低电压的转换,另一个用于从低电压到高电压的转换。通过这种方式,数据可以在两个电压域之间双向流动,同时保持信号的完整性。此外,这种设计还能够隔离总线的一部分,例如当某些设备处于低功耗模式或关闭状态时,避免它们对总线的干扰。 电平转换器的使用不仅限于I²C总线,还可以应用于其他总线系统或点对点连接,比如SPI、UART等。它提供了一种高效且经济的方法来解决不同电源电压设备之间的通信问题,特别是在现代电子产品中,低电压组件的广泛使用使得电平转换成为系统设计的关键组成部分。 AN97055文档详细介绍了如何使用单个N-MOSFET实现双向电平转换器,这对于需要兼容不同电源电压的I²C总线和其他通信系统的设计师来说是一个非常实用的资源。该技术不仅可以确保数据的准确传输,还可以增强系统的灵活性和可靠性。